Understanding the Role of Child Protective Services in Daycare Abuse Investigations
In Syracuse, when allegations of daycare abuse surface, Child Protective Services (CPS) plays a pivotal role in investigating and ensuring the safety of children. CPS is charged with receiving and assessing reports of child abuse and neglect, including sexual abuse within childcare settings. They act swiftly to safeguard vulnerable kids by conducting thorough examinations.
A Sexual Abuse Lawyer New York would highlight that CPS’s investigation involves interviewing relevant parties, gathering evidence, and determining the credibility of claims. Their goal is not only to penalize perpetrators but also to support victims through the process. By collaborating with law enforcement and healthcare professionals, CPS ensures a comprehensive response to daycare abuse, holding accountable those who violate trust in caregiving positions.
The Legal Framework and Procedures for Proving Daycare Sexual Abuse in New York
In New York, the legal framework for investigating and prosecuting daycare sexual abuse is designed to protect children and ensure justice. If a child makes an allegation of sexual abuse at a daycare center, it’s imperative that the incident is reported immediately to Child Protective Services (CPS). CPS has specific procedures in place to handle such cases sensitively and thoroughly. They begin by conducting a thorough investigation, interviewing the child, parents, caregivers, and other relevant individuals. During this process, a Sexual Abuse Lawyer New York can play a crucial role in guiding parents on their rights and ensuring that evidence is preserved.
The CPS investigation aims to gather substantial evidence to prove beyond a reasonable doubt that sexual abuse occurred. This includes physical evidence, medical records, witness statements, and any relevant surveillance footage. Once the investigation is complete, CPS makes a determination on whether the allegations are founded. If the evidence supports the claim, they can refer the case to law enforcement for further proceedings, potentially leading to charges against the perpetrators.
